X12 856 Dell Inbound VMI 4010 856

X12 Release 4010

This Draft Standard for Trial Use contains the format and establishes the data contents of the Ship Notice/Manifest Transaction Set (856) for use within the context of an Electronic Data Interchange (EDI) environment. The transaction set can be used to list the contents of a shipment of goods as well as additional information relating to the shipment, such as order information, product description, physical characteristics, type of packaging, marking, carrier information, and configuration of goods within the transportation equipment. The transaction set enables the sender to describe the contents and configuration of a shipment in various levels of detail and provides an ordered flexibility to convey information.

The sender of this transaction is the organization responsible for detailing and communicating the contents of a shipment, or shipments, to one or more receivers of the transaction set. The receiver of this transaction set can be any organization having an interest in the contents of a shipment or information about the contents of a shipment.

    Summary

    CTT
    010
    Summary > CTT

    Transaction Totals

    OptionalMax use 1

    To transmit a hash total for a specific element in the transaction set

    • Number of line items (CTT01) is the accumulation of the number of HL segments.
      If used, hash total (CTT02) is the sum of the value of units shipped (SN102) for each SN1 segment.
    Example
    CTT-01
    354
    Number of Line Items
    Required
    Numeric (N0)
    Min 1Max 6

    Total number of line items in the transaction set

    CTT-02
    347
    Hash Total
    Optional
    Decimal number (R)
    Min 1Max 10

    Sum of values of the specified data element. All values in the data element will be summed without regard to decimal points (explicit or implicit) or signs. Truncation will occur on the left most digits if the sum is greater than the maximum size of the hash total of the data element.

    ## Example:
    -.0018 First occurrence of value being hashed.
    .18 Second occurrence of value being hashed.
    1.8 Third occurrence of value being hashed.
    18.01 Fourth occurrence of value being hashed.

    1855 Hash total prior to truncation.
    855 Hash total after truncation to three-digit field.
